Describe a direct ELISA test:

A
  1. Antigens bound to well plate.
  2. A detection antibody with an enzyme attached is added to well plate.
  3. If antigen is complementary then will bind.
  4. Well is washed out to remove unbound antibody.
  5. Substrate solution added, colour change = positive presence of antigen.

Describe an indirect ELISA test:

A
  1. Antigen added to bottom of well in well plate.
  2. Sample added, antibodies will bind to antigen if present. Well washed out.
  3. Secondary antibody with enzyme attached is added which attaches to first antibody. Well washed again.
  4. Substrate solution added which will react with the enzyme and cause a colour change which is a positive result.
